
Feathered Star Quilt
Unidentified Quilt Maker
Circa 1880
73 x 90 inches
Origin Unknown
Large scale "Feathered Star," meticulously pieced and hand quilted. I like how it looks like the Stars are holding hands!
The small diamonds and triangles that make up the Stars are of a range of turn-of-the-century printed fabrics, mostly reds, pinks, and indigoes. The quilt maker alternated those prints with solid white triangles to great graphic effect.
More unusual choices are the variety of creamy brown prints in the larger triangles... and the dense blue and white printed floral of the ground fabric.
